I really wanted to win a contest where you had to make something. Well I worked really hard on my entry then I saw the other entries and they were better than mine. How do I get over that I'm not going to win, please don't be mean!

Try to think about how hard the others worked on their projects too. Try to accept that as much as we want to be the best at everything we do there will always be someone better or prettier, whatever. This doesn't mean that what you did was no good just that maybe next time you'll have to try harder whether by putting more thought into what you're doing, go to the library to get some ideas. Maybe you could ask the other people who had so-called better ideas how they came up with what they came up with.
You also said that you're not going to win...how do you know that? Give yourself credit for what you did and stop being so hard on yourself.

Did you make something you really like? Did you enjoy making it? Then you can still be proud of it and pleased with yourself.

The world is full of smart and talented people. You know this because you are one of them yourself. Some of them are always going to do better than you at some things. Everyone wants to win, not everyone can. This is the reality of life and yes, it can make you feel bad sometimes. But hold your head up regarding your own accomplishments.
